This is for most of the Caribbean but is specifically St. Croix in January. Temps- mid 80s highs, mid 70s lows, if it rains chances are mostly light scattered showers, it's driest at the end of Jan. NY to STX is likely a quick flight to Miami and on to STX. It's hard not to have something to do here. There are mountains, rainforest, beaches, museums, parks, watersports, etc... We were here for 8 full days and still didn't see everything we wanted to.
